 Team Report
Next Match: away to Mallorca, May 18

Real Zaragoza's troublesome season could yet have a happy ending. The club has had four coaches and sits in eighteenth place with one game left following a string of disastrous results midway through the campaign. However, a win at Mallorca on Sunday will see the club stay up. Albert Celades is relishing the challenge. "I love these kind of games. We (the players) are privileged, although I wouldn't choose to be in this situation," he said. Sergio Garcia is doubtful, but Luis Carlos Cuartero, David Generelo and Carlos Diogo remain sidelined and Javier Paredes is suspended. A tie could be enough to save Zaragoza, depending on other results. Mallorca is still competing for a place in Europe next season.
